Grass is everywhere, yet capturing its delicate texture is one of the trickiest aspects of botanical art. Its light, airy appearance, varied movement in the wind, and subtle color gradients make it an ideal subject for artists of all levels. By mastering grass drawing, you’ll improve your shading, blending, and line control skills—essential foundations for realistic botanical drawings, landscape art, and even character background design.

Easy Tips to Make Your Grass Drawing Stand Out

  • Use a light pencil first—easily correction supports natural creativity.
  • Vary stroke direction and pressure to reflect real grass behavior.
  • Add directional shadows for volume and realism.
  • Include contrasting leaf clusters to prevent a flat look.
  • Try different grass types: rushing meadow, towering wheat, or fine fern-like blades.
